**About the role**:
The role offers an exciting opportunity to work for a Global Expansion Markets (GEM) division, one of Reckitt’s affiliates.

In this role, the individual will be working closely with the Quality Manager/Responsible Person to deliver the Global Expansion Markets programmes and initiatives, enabling the launch of key Reckitt’s brands in whitespaces, spanning across a variety of regulatory classifications (e.g. medicines, medical devices, cosmetics, biocides, infant nutrition, VMS), building strong Quality culture to enable GEM to grow in a long-term, sustainable way

The role will be act as a Quality Specialist and support ongoing GDP compliance with the GEM Wholesale Distribution Authorisation.

**Your responsibilities**:

- Collaborate with trusted external Partners to enable the GEM business to grow rapidly whilst ensuring visibility and maintenance of Quality compliance
- Support the Responsible Person in ensuring GDP Compliance of the GEM Quality
- Management System and ensuring compliance to the regulatory requirements, Marketing Authorisation, and the Wholesaler Distribution Authorisation
- Be proactive to establish strong Quality foundations of the business and support cross-functional teams in development of strong Quality pillars for long-term, sustainable growth
- Ensure company identified self-inspection & audits are performed at required intervals, as well as support the Quality Manager with any inspections/ audits hosted in the local business unit
- Partner with the Quality manager to deliver GDP training to all relevant employees & partners
- Maintain QMS trackers and prepare metrics/ KPIs for Quality Management Review
- Be responsible for training matrix & curricula management for new joiners & existing employees
- Perform supplier and customer qualifications, including review of quality questionnaires, bone fide checks and management of TAs, as required
- Manage & support Deviations, CAPAs, Complaints & Change Controls, Activation Records within the QMS, as well as partner with the business to ensure effectiveness of these processes
- Keep accurate and up-to-date GDP records as such the documents are legible, traceable, and retainable

**The experience we're looking for**:

- Experience working in quality compliance in a Healthcare related industry
- Practical experience in handling & distribution of medicinal products
- Strong understanding of Good Distribution Practices
- Attention to detail & compliance with data integrity principles.
- Desirable - Experience in internal & external auditing with ISO, GDP is an advantage
